Henry the Horse Needs our Help --- Please Read

The SPCA has a young horse named Henry who had a very serious colic and needed an operation to save his life. Henry is a beautiful Paso Fino gelding that is approx 2 years old. He was abandoned and came in as a stallion. Henry has gone from crazed stallion to a sweet and loving gelding in a very short period of time. We have begun to train and ride him and we couldn't think of putting him down after his bout with colic. The cost to save Henry was over $7000.00. We were fortunate to find two horse/animal lovers who donated $1000.00 each to save Henry. We need an additional $5000.00 so that the SPCA can continue to treat and feed the 29 horses that are presently at our facility. Henry is coming back from the Surgical Unit in Palm Beach today. His prognosis is good and he should make a full recovery.
